Fiscal End Date | Revenue | Change | Growth |
---|---|---|---|
Dec 31, 2024 | 1.83B | 415.30M | +29.38% |
Dec 31, 2023 | 1.41B | 499.00M | +54.55% |
Dec 31, 2022 | 914.70M | -43.30M | -4.52% |
Dec 31, 2021 | 958.00M | -287.40M | -23.08% |
Dec 31, 2020 | 1.25B | -97.30M | -7.25% |
Dec 31, 2019 | 1.34B | 170.10M | +14.51% |
Dec 31, 2018 | 1.17B | 376.80M | +47.35% |
Dec 31, 2017 | 795.80M | 354.30M | +80.25% |
Dec 31, 2016 | 441.50M | ― | ― |